Abstract

A premix gas burner (100) comprises a metal mounting plate (102) for mounting the premix gas burner in a heating appliance; a metal plate structure (104) and a burner deck (106). The burner deck comprises a woven wire mesh on the outer surface of which premix gas is combusted after the premix gas has flown through the woven wire mesh. The woven wire mesh comprises a circumferential edge (108). The circumferential edge comprises a plurality of tabs (110). The mounting plate comprises a central opening. The burner deck is inserted through the central opening. The metal mounting plate or the metal plate structure comprises at least one ridge (112). The at least one ridge comprises at least one notch (114). Each of the tabs is positioned in a notch. The metal mounting plate and the metal plate structure are in contact with each other at the top of the ridge, such that the open side of the at least one notch is covered; and such that the tabs are held in between the metal mounting plate and the metal plate structure with play being present of the tabs relative to the metal mounting plate and relative to the metal plate structure.

MODE(S) FOR CARRYING OUT THE INVENTION

[0027] FIG. 1 shows an exploded view of an example of a premix gas burner 100 according to the invention. The premix gas burner 100 comprises a metal mounting plate 102 for mounting the premix gas burner in a heating appliance; a metal plate structure 104 and a burner deck 106. The full surface of the burner deck has a convex shape. The burner deck consists out of a woven wire mesh on the outer surface of which premix gas is combusted after the premix gas has flown through the woven wire mesh. The woven wire mesh e.g. is 0.9 mm thick. The woven wire mesh comprises a circumferential edge 108. The circumferential edge comprises a plurality of tabs 110. The tabs are an integral part of the woven wire mesh. In the burner, the tabs are parallel with the mounting plate.

[0028] The mounting plate comprises a central opening. The burner deck is inserted through the central opening. The central opening is also provided for the supply of premix gas to the burner when the burner is in operation. The metal mounting plate 102 comprises a ridge 112. The ridge surrounds the complete burner deck. The ridge comprises a number of notches 114.

[0029] In the burner, each of the tabs 110 is positioned in a notch 114. In the burner, the metal mounting plate 102 and the metal plate structure 104 are in contact with each other at the top of the ridge, such that the open side of the at least one notch is covered; and such that the tabs are held in between the metal mounting plate and the metal plate structure with play being present of the tabs relative to the metal mounting plate and relative to the metal plate structure. In the burner, the metal plate structure can be e.g. be welded to the metal mounting plate at their contacting points. In the exemplary burner, the playwhich is the difference between the metal mounting plate and the metal plate structure from which the thickness of the woven wire mesh is subtractedis 0.6 mm.

[0030] The metal plate structure 104 comprises a plurality of perforations 116, provided for flow of premix gas through the perforations 116 before the premix gas flows through the woven wire mesh.

[0031] The circumference of the burner deck has the shape of a rectangle of which the two short sides have been continuously rounded. Tabs are only provided along the two long sides of the rectangular shape of the circumference of the burner deck. No tabs are provided along the continuously rounded short sides.

[0032] As an alternative to providing the ridge (and the notches in the ridge) in the metal mounting plate, the ridges (and the notches in the ridge) can be provided in the metal plate structure. The remainder of the burner can be the same as in the example of FIG. 1.
